American Manganese announces RecyLiCo Demonstration plant ready for commissioning

 

 

 

 

American Manganese Chief Technical Officer and Director Zarko Meseldzija joined Steve Darling from Proactive to share news the company is announcing the equipment for its demonstration plant is ready for commissioning.

 

Meseldzija says the plant is designed to demonstrate the RecycLiCo process in continuous operating conditions that will show the company can run the complete process and provide input for commercial operation. The demonstration plant will operate with a cathode scrap processing capacity of 500 kg/day.
